Explaining Blockchain
Blockchain = Read & Append Only Database
New accounts = $0
Transaction = Transfer from Account A to B
Database is ONLY list of TRANSFER transactions

Crypto-Currency Wallet
Your account control comes from your “Wallet”, which is a Private asymmetric encryption key.
Your Public Key is your Crypto-Current Address.
Transactions are “Signed” with your private key (aka wallet)
Local software challenge
Using crypto-currency can require installing local software.
The local software has access to your WALLET on your local computer.
PRO: Harder to use. People hate installing software.CON: Ultra-secure (possibly)
Or use the cloud
Or you can use a cloud provider (like)
PROs: No local software.CONs: Security returns to equaling banks.
Local wallet keys
Local WALLETs are:
More secure: in the case of risk of cloud banking
(Mt Gox or a bank)
Less Secure: Local computer hacked or data loss.

Rome
Gov Needs Money Dilute Collapse
Around the time of Rome’s collapse, the denarius contained only 0.02%
silver and virtually nobody accepted it as a medium of
exchange or a store of value
France
French revolutionDefault on Debt ~1785
People Starve
1795 currency inflates by 13,000%
